Peloni:  In the following video, Victor Davis Hanson states, “?If you want to give reparations, how about all the people who died fighting in World War I, World War II, Vietnam, and Korea? What did they get.”  Victor Davis Hanson discusses pro-Palestinian protests in Jewish neighborhoods in New York City, arguing that political and campus culture have contributed to rising antisemitism and broader social disorder. He outlines what he calls the “four horsemen” of modern antisemitism: immigration-driven demographic change, DEI ideology, shifts within the Democratic Party, and left-wing popular culture, while also criticizing parts of the populist right.   The conversation also covers immigration and sanctuary policies, comments by Alejandro Mayorkas on border policy, reports on Oct. 7 atrocities, Harvard University’s reparations initiative, crime and early release policies, and upcoming political issues.
